Troubleshooting Ollama Call Failed with Status Code 500: Invalid Version Error Explained

The "Ollama Call Failed with Status Code 500: Invalid Version" error can be a frustrating issue for developers working with the Ollama API. This error typically indicates that there's a problem with the version of the API or the client library being used. In this article, we'll explore the possible causes of this error and provide a step-by-step guide on how to troubleshoot and resolve it.

Causes of the Ollama Call Failed with Status Code 500: Invalid Version Error

The "Ollama Call Failed with Status Code 500: Invalid Version" error can occur due to several reasons, including:

  • Incompatible API version: The client library or API being used may not be compatible with the version of the Ollama API.
  • Outdated client library: The client library being used may be outdated and not support the latest version of the Ollama API.
  • Incorrect API endpoint: The API endpoint being used may be incorrect or not properly configured.
  • Server-side issues: Server-side issues, such as a misconfigured server or a bug in the API, can also cause this error.

Troubleshooting Steps

To troubleshoot the "Ollama Call Failed with Status Code 500: Invalid Version" error, follow these steps:

  1. Check the API version: Ensure that the client library or API being used is compatible with the version of the Ollama API. You can check the API version by reviewing the API documentation or contacting the API support team.
  2. Update the client library: If the client library is outdated, update it to the latest version. You can check for updates on the client library's GitHub page or by running a command like pip install --upgrade ollama-client.
  3. Verify the API endpoint: Ensure that the API endpoint being used is correct and properly configured. You can check the API endpoint by reviewing the API documentation or contacting the API support team.
  4. Check server-side logs: If the issue persists, check the server-side logs for any errors or issues. You can contact the API support team or review the server-side logs to identify the root cause of the issue.
Troubleshooting Step Description
1. Check API version Ensure compatibility with Ollama API version
2. Update client library Update client library to latest version
3. Verify API endpoint Ensure correct and properly configured API endpoint
4. Check server-side logs Identify server-side errors or issues
đź’ˇ When troubleshooting the "Ollama Call Failed with Status Code 500: Invalid Version" error, it's essential to have a clear understanding of the API version, client library, and API endpoint being used. This will help you identify the root cause of the issue and resolve it efficiently.

Key Points

  • The "Ollama Call Failed with Status Code 500: Invalid Version" error typically indicates a problem with the API version or client library.
  • Incompatible API version, outdated client library, incorrect API endpoint, and server-side issues can cause this error.
  • Troubleshooting steps include checking the API version, updating the client library, verifying the API endpoint, and checking server-side logs.
  • Having a clear understanding of the API version, client library, and API endpoint is crucial for efficient troubleshooting.

Resolving the Error

Once you've identified the root cause of the "Ollama Call Failed with Status Code 500: Invalid Version" error, you can take the necessary steps to resolve it. Here are some possible solutions:

  • Update the client library: If the client library is outdated, update it to the latest version.
  • Change the API endpoint: If the API endpoint is incorrect or not properly configured, change it to the correct one.
  • Contact the API support team: If the issue persists, contact the API support team for further assistance.

What causes the Ollama Call Failed with Status Code 500: Invalid Version error?

+

The Ollama Call Failed with Status Code 500: Invalid Version error can be caused by several factors, including incompatible API version, outdated client library, incorrect API endpoint, and server-side issues.

How do I troubleshoot the Ollama Call Failed with Status Code 500: Invalid Version error?

+

To troubleshoot the error, check the API version, update the client library, verify the API endpoint, and check server-side logs.

How do I resolve the Ollama Call Failed with Status Code 500: Invalid Version error?

+

To resolve the error, update the client library, change the API endpoint, or contact the API support team for further assistance.

In conclusion, the “Ollama Call Failed with Status Code 500: Invalid Version” error can be a challenging issue to resolve, but by following the troubleshooting steps and understanding the possible causes, you can efficiently identify and resolve the issue.